Management Meeting Minutes — Reseller Programme

Present: Dena Forsgate, Ollie Rennick, Priya Calloway.

Quick recap: the Fernlight reseller programme is tracking ahead of plan — 14 partners signed versus the 10 we'd hoped for. Margins are a bit thinner than modelled, mostly down to the tiered discount we offered early joiners. Ollie will tighten the discount bands before the next intake. Where we want to take the programme next is covered in the note below.

board note of yahip-tadug: Headcount on the Zorath team goes from 9 to 100 by the end of April. Gross margin on Zorath came in at 10 percent against a plan of 20 percent.

Hello plugin authors,

Next Thursday, Corbexa will run a disaster-recovery drill for the RestockRoute vending-machine restock planner. During the failover window, plugin callbacks will be replayed against the standby scheduler, so please ensure your handlers are idempotent and tolerate duplicate route assignments. No customer restock data will be altered. To re-register your plugin against the standby environment during the drill, authenticate with the recovery passphrase provided below.

vault phrase of hahip-tajeg = quenax-briath-briax

### Step 4: Sign the build

LiftSim deploys go through the Carrell release gateway, which rejects unsigned artifacts. After the simulation regression suite passes, package the dispatch engine and the floor-traffic scenarios into one bundle. New team members often forget the scenarios — the gateway checks both. Sign the bundle with the deploy key shown below.

deploy key for kajof-fajop: bky6_gDHw9Q

### Fan-out backpressure

If the Hornpipe notifier queue depth climbs past the amber threshold, don't restart workers first — check the downstream consumer lag. Usually one slow shard is throttling the whole fan-out. Pause the offending shard, let buffers drain, then resume. Step-by-step commands are on the internal page here.

wiki page, tahaf-tajog: https://jira.ordindyn.corp/pipeline